GSRP vs K-12 Teacher Salary

A comparison of salary between GSRP lead teachers and K-12 teachers in 2021-22.

1. Community-Based Organization (CBO) Provider: College/University, Head Start Grantee or Delegate, Non-Profit, Private For-Profit, Private Non-Profit, or Public For-Profit.

2. School-Based Provider: District/PSA or ISD.

3. 2021-22 BULLETIN 1014. Michigan Public School Districts Ranked By Selected Financial Data. Published February 2023.

# FTE - Full-time equivalent.

# LTs - Number of lead teachers. The sum might be slightly smaller in some ISDs than the total number reported in the 2021-22 GSRP annual report, because a few GSRP locations did not have information about the provider type.

Not available - In ISDs where there were only up to two (2) lead teachers at a specific provider type, their median salary is not reported.
